Why Might You Need a Local Locksmith for Your Car?
Car locksmith professionals are specialized professionals trained to deal with a range of automotive lock and key issues. Here are some typical scenarios where their services are necessary:

Car Lockouts: This is the most common factor to call a vehicle locksmith. If you've mistakenly locked your keys inside your car or lost them altogether, a locksmith can assist you gain access without triggering damage.

Lost or Stolen Keys: Losing your car keys or having them stolen is difficult, but a replacement key can be quickly crafted by a knowledgeable locksmith.

Broken Keys: Over time, car keys can break, and sometimes, they may even break within your car's lock or ignition. A locksmith can safely extract the broken key and replace it.

Faulty Car Locks: Locks can become jammed or fail due to rust, wear, or damage. A locksmith can repair or replace harmed locks on doors or trunks.

Transponder Key Programming: Modern cars and trucks frequently utilize transponder keys with embedded microchips for included security. A locksmith with the right tools can program these keys to sync with your vehicle.

Key Fob Issues: If your car's key fob quits working, locksmith professionals can either repair the existing remote or provide you with a brand-new one.

Key Considerations When Choosing a Local Locksmith for Your Car
Picking the right locksmith is critical to guaranteeing the safety and security of your vehicle. To make an informed option, consider the following aspects:
1. Certifications and Licensing
Inspect if the locksmith is accredited to run in your location. Accredited locksmith professionals are required to adhere to industry requirements and regulations, making sure that they provide reliable services.
2. Experience
Search for a locksmith with substantial experience in automotive lock systems. A seasoned specialist is better geared up to handle the most recent innovations, consisting of transponder keys and keyless entry systems.
3. Track record
Read online evaluations, request for referrals, or take a look at customer testimonials to gauge the locksmith's credibility. A well-reviewed locksmith is most likely to provide reputable services.
4. Series of Services
Ensure the locksmith uses a wide range of automotive services, from key duplication to lock repair. This guarantees that they can handle any unpredicted issues.
5. Reaction Time
Time is of the essence during a car lockout or emergency. A locksmith who guarantees quick action times is invaluable.
6. Pricing
While the cost of services shouldn't be your sole consideration, it's important to understand the locksmith's rates structure. Be cautious of extremely low rates, as they can in some cases suggest subpar work or surprise fees.
7. Insurance
Ensure the locksmith has liability insurance to cover any unintentional damages that might take place during the service.
8. Availability
Locksmith problems can develop at any time, so it's vital to choose a specialist who uses 24/7 services.

1. How much does it cost to employ a local car locksmith?The cost varies
depending upon the service you need. For instance, a simple car lockout service may cost ₤ 50-- ₤ 150, while key replacement or programming can be ₤ 100-- ₤ 300, depending upon the intricacy.

2. Can a locksmith make a replacement key without the original?Yes, a professional locksmith can create a replacement key even if you do not have the original. They can utilize your car's VIN(Vehicle Identification Number)or special key codes for this function. 3. Will a locksmith damage my car throughout service?No, a

trustworthy locksmith utilizes specialized tools and techniques to prevent harmful your vehicle while accessing or repairing the locking system. 4. The length of time does it consider a locksmith to open a car?In most cases, opening a car

takes anywhere from 5 to 30 minutes, depending upon the type of lock
and car design. 5. Do locksmith professionals handle key fob programming?Yes, many locksmiths are geared up to program key fobs and transponder keys
, typically at a much lower cost than a dealer. 6. What need to I do if my key breaks in the ignition?Turn off the car and prevent trying to extract the key yourself, as this could trigger further damage.

Call a locksmith immediately-- they have the tools to eliminate the broken piece without harming the ignition.
